The Bachelor of Business Administration in Supply Chain Management or BBA in Supply Chain Management, is a 3-year bachelor's degree divided into 6 semesters. The Bachelor's in SCM course focuses on logistics, purchases, distribution and inventory management. The course is designed to enhance the skills in supply planning, warehouse operations, vendor management, transportation and supply chain analytics.

 

To pursue the BBA in Supply Chain Management, students must complete their 10+2 or a similar exam with at least 50% - 60% marks from a recognized board. Candidates of all streams, like science, commerce, or art, can apply for this course. Admissions are generally based on entrance examinations such as CUET UG, NPAT, and some institutions may conduct interviews and document verification.

 

Internship, live supply chain projects, industrial visits and seminars are integrated into the course to enhance practical learning. Top institutions offering BBA Supply Chain Management include LPU, Srinivas University, UPES, REVA University, Ajeenkya DY Patil University, and many more. The course fee based on the institute ranges from INR 3,09,000 - INR 8,37,000.

 

Graduates are hired by companies such as ITC, Larsen & Toubro Limited, Delhivery, Tata Group, Reliance Digital, BigBasket, and Amazon. Popular job roles include Logistics and Supply Chain Management Manager, Procurement Manager, Operations Manager, and Inventory Manager, including a salary package ranging from INR 2 to 42 LPA, depending on the role and experience.

What is BBA Supply Chain Management?

Bachelor of Business Administration in Supply Chain Management is a graduate program that teaches students how to manage the movement of goods, services and information. This includes subjects related to logistics, procurement, transportation, inventory control and warehousing. The course mixes theoretical knowledge with practical tools and industry case studies. Students also learn about global supply networks and operational strategies.

 

The BBA SCM course also includes modern techniques such as ERP systems, data analytics and automation to increase supply chain efficiency. Students are trained in such ways so that they can analyze and optimize supply processes in industries. The program also includes internships, live projects and industry exposure to create practical experience. Graduates are ready for roles like executive, logistics analyst or procurement coordinator.

 

Why Study BBA Supply Chain Management?

A BBA in Supply Chain Management course includes subjects such as logistics operations, inventory control and many more. It prepares students for careers in logistics planning, warehouse management and operations. Students interested in process optimization, distribution networks, and real-time supply systems will greatly benefit from this program. There are some reasons related to why study BBA Supply Chain Management:

  • With the rapid expansion of companies like Amazon, Flipkart and Hindustan Unilever, demand for efficient supply chain professionals has increased.
  • Unlike other business degrees, this course provides direct entry into roles like warehouse planning, vendor management and cost-effective delivery.
  • India's logistics sector is set to reach USD 800 billion by 2030, through policies such as digitization, infrastructure upgrades, and PM Gati Shakti, and NLP demand for skilled talent is increasing.
  • The BBA SCM course includes training in ERP software, SAP, logistics automation tools and data dashboards. It provides students with a job in a digitally managed supply network.
  • Students can achieve insight into international logistics standards, INCOTERMS and customs processes. It helps to work with multinational companies or export-import departments.

BBA Supply Chain Management Eligibility Criteria

A candidate must fulfill specific eligibility requirements to pursue a BBA in Supply Chain Management; otherwise, admission to this program may be challenging. The eligibility requirements for the BBA Supply Chain Management course in India are listed below:

  • Candidates need to complete their 10+2 education or an equivalent qualification from a recognized board.
  • The minimum marks required for BBA in supply chain management should be between 50 - 60% in 10+2.
  • Few colleges prefer students with a commerce or mathematics background, but many art and science students are also accepted.
  • Some institutes conduct entrance exams like LPUNEST, SET, and many more. While, there are colleges who accept the national-level entrance exams like CUET UG, and many more.

BBA Supply Chain Management Admission Process 2025

The Supply Chain Management BBA Admission Process at Lovely Professional University (LPU) includes the following stages:

 

Step 1: Register on the LPUADMIT portal using basic details like name, email ID and mobile number. Your email becomes your user name, and after the registration is completed you will get a confirmation email.

 

Step 2: Fill the application form, then select your BBA program you are interested in, and generate your provisional registration number by paying INR 10,000. Upload all the required documents like photo, ID proof and marksheet.

 

Step 3: Pay the fee of INR 1000 - INR 1500 for LPUNEST and fill the form to apply for the scholarship examination. Your performance in LPUNEST can get you significant fee adjustments.

 

Step 4: Choose a specific date, time and mode for the LPUNEST exam (center-based or online). To qualify for a scholarship and be seen for testing on the scheduled date and time to secure a seat in the program.

 

Documents Required:

  • 10th Class Certificate
  • 12th Class Certificate
  • Exam Rank/Score Card (LPUNEST exam)
  • Passport-size photographs

BBA Supply Chain Management Job FAQs

Can a student study higher studies after BBA in Supply Chain Management?

Yes, students can pursue an MBA in Supply Chain, Logistics, or Operations to qualify for managerial roles. This helps to develop strategic skills for leadership roles in the organizations. Certificates like CSCP or Six Sigma also add value to the profile.

Do candidates need to know about computer skills for jobs in the supply chain?

Yes, computer skills are necessary for roles related to planning and tracking in supply chain and logistics. Knowledge of MS Excel, ERP software, and data tools is important. These modern logistics help in managing operations efficiently in the environment.

What skills are essential for a successful supply chain career?

Strong communication, time management and problem-solving skills are important. Analytical thinking and adaptation abilities are also important in logistics roles. Familiarity with the supply chain software promotes the readiness for the job opportunities.

Is BBA better than BBA in Supply Chain Management?

If a candidate is interested in logistics, this specialization provides the student better industry alignment. It provides training focusing in high-value areas such as operations and sourcing. Compared to the general BBA, it opens specific job opportunities.

Which certifications will be helpful during or after BBA in Supply Chain Management?

Certificates such as CSCP, Six Sigma and SAP SCM improve technical skills and job prospects. These certifications are globally recognized and valuable by employers. These will help the candidates to qualify for senior roles and better salary packages.

What is the role of technology in supply chain jobs?

Technology enables efficient inventory tracking, route adaptation, and demand forecast. Tools such as AI, ERP and IoT are widely used in logistics. Being tech-savvy is essential in modern supply chain management.
